Despite the positive outlook, the compaction grouting service market faces several challenges. One major constraint is the inherent site-specific nature of the work; each project requires tailored solutions, increasing complexity and potentially impacting project timelines and costs. Variations in soil conditions can lead to unexpected difficulties and require adjustments to the grouting process, potentially leading to increased expenses and delays. Furthermore, the availability of skilled labor specializing in compaction grouting can be a limiting factor, especially in certain regions. Competition from alternative ground improvement techniques, such as soil nailing or deep mixing, also presents a challenge. The high initial investment required for specialized equipment and trained personnel can deter smaller companies from entering the market, limiting competition in some areas. Finally, environmental concerns related to the use of certain grouting materials and the potential impact on groundwater need to be carefully managed, necessitating adherence to stringent environmental regulations and potentially increasing project costs. Addressing these challenges will be vital for sustained market growth.
The Building Sites application segment is projected to dominate the compaction grouting market throughout the forecast period. This is driven by the enormous and ongoing expansion of the global construction industry. The increasing number of high-rise buildings and large-scale construction projects necessitate robust ground stabilization techniques to ensure structural integrity and prevent settlement issues. Compaction grouting offers a cost-effective and reliable solution to enhance soil bearing capacity and prevent ground movement, making it a preferred choice for many developers and construction firms.
Within the building sites application, the segment focused on compactable soft soils is particularly significant. Many urban areas feature challenging soil conditions, and compaction grouting effectively addresses the need for ground stabilization before foundation construction. The process provides increased load-bearing capacity, reducing settlement risk and ensuring the long-term stability of the structures. This makes it a critical component in large-scale construction projects, leading to a significant demand for compaction grouting services within this specific segment.
